邮戳在正文中嵌入图像

Posted

技术标签:

【中文标题】邮戳在正文中嵌入图像【英文标题】:postmark embed image in body 【发布时间】:2014-07-05 22:30:58 【问题描述】:

我正在使用 Postmark 发送电子邮件并希望将图像嵌入到 html_body 中。我能够想到两种方法来做到这一点。

    获取 html 正文,在其中搜索图像标签。提取图片标签的src并创建一个带有内容id的附件并将其传递给邮戳。 创建多部分 MIME 消息并将其发送到邮戳 html_body(但不确定邮戳是否能够处理此问题)。

请建议我您可以考虑其他任何方式。 也让我知道第 2 点是否可行。

【问题讨论】:

【参考方案1】:

你可以使用任何一种方式来做到这一点。

如果您使用 API,那么您可以使用您建议的第一种方法,然后只需关注this example(搜索内嵌图片附件)。

如果您使用 SMTP,您可以将多部分 MIME 消息与图像作为内联/MIME 附件包含在内,Postmark 将自动处理。

【讨论】:

以上是关于邮戳在正文中嵌入图像的主要内容,如果未能解决你的问题,请参考以下文章

在电子邮件正文中嵌入 base64 图像

Mandrill Mailchimp 如何在电子邮件正文中嵌入图像

如何在 iOS 中将图像嵌入到电子邮件的 HTML 正文中

图像在 MSCRM 2011 的电子邮件正文中不可见

Outlook 将图像显示为在邮件的 HTML 正文中引用的附件

是否可以像 Outlook RTF/TNEF 那样在 html 电子邮件中嵌入非图像附件?